Output 654a8020919db7fd2e50de7ef239004ab9559ae0d0ae24fafd7af3ed9862c85a:1

value
103596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0ea4aeead6c8b23ad14a27093fbdf5f0f1887d8 OP_EQUAL
address
3Ljf9PQ2tu1ARveNAEJxHKeEXM5aAWWXzJ
transaction
654a8020919db7fd2e50de7ef239004ab9559ae0d0ae24fafd7af3ed9862c85a
spent
true